Hello. I removed my credit card from Paypal before I was issued a refund. Will I still get my money back even though I removed that credit card? How long does it usually take for the amount to be credited back?

If you DIDN'T fund your initial payment from your Paypal balance but funded it from your bank account or a card then once marked refunded it will automatically go back to that bank account or card. Paypal say allow 30 days although its normally much quicker than that, country dependent.
As long as your card ACCOUNT is still open then it should go through ok.
